Abstract
A poly(carboxylate) cement pack comprising a water soluble poly(carboxylic acid) having a relative viscosity of from 1.05 to 2.00, a chelating agent and a cement powder which will react with the poly(carboxylic acid) in the presence of the chelating agent and water to give a plastic mass which rapidly hardens to form a poly(carboxylate) cement.
